Calculate the total number of possible 5-digit combinations on a keypad with only 6 keys.

Final answer:

To calculate the number of 5-digit combinations on a keypad with 6 keys, one must raise 6 to the power of 5, resulting in 7776 different combinations.

Step-by-step explanation:

The student has asked to calculate the total number of possible 5-digit combinations on a keypad with only 6 keys. To find this, we use the principle that the number of possible outcomes (or microstates) of any repeated independent situation is the base number of choices raised to the power of the number of times you are making those choices. Since there are 6 keys and each key can be used in each of the 5 positions, the total number of combinations is 6 to the power of 5, which is 6 x 6 x 6 x 6 x 6.

To calculate this, we do the math: 6 multiplied by 6 is 36, 36 multiplied by 6 is 216, 216 multiplied by 6 is 1296, and finally, 1296 multiplied by 6 gives us 7776. Therefore, there are 7776 possible 5-digit combinations on a keypad with 6 keys.
